Описание
ELSA-2011-1385: kdelibs and kdelibs3 security update (MODERATE)
[3.5.10-24.1]
- Resolves: bz#746160, CVE-2011-3365, input validation failure in KSSL

Связанные уязвимости
The KDE SSL Wrapper (KSSL) API in KDE SC 4.6.0 through 4.7.1, and possibly earlier versions, does not use a certain font when rendering certificate fields in a security dialog, which allows remote attackers to spoof the common name (CN) of a certificate via rich text.
